Warning Signs You Need Trim & Baseboard Replacement After Water Damage
Catching water damage early can save you thousands of dollars in repairs and prevent bigger problems down the line. Be on the lookout for these warning signs and don’t hesitate to contact us if you suspect water damage in your Grand Ronde, OR home. A quick response can make all the difference in preventing further damage and ensuring a successful restoration.
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away
Unpleasant odors can be a clear indication of water damage. If you notice a persistent musty smell in your home, it’s essential to investigate further. Don’t ignore the issue; it could be a sign of mold growth or other health risks.
Warped or Discolored Trim and Baseboards
Water damage can cause trim and baseboards to warp or discolor, compromising their structural integrity. If you notice any changes in the appearance of your trim and baseboards, it’s time to act. Don’t delay; prompt attention can prevent further damage.
Water Stains or Warping on Walls and Floors
Water damage can cause unsightly stains or warping on walls and floors, affecting the aesthetic appeal of your home. If you notice any signs of water damage, don’t hesitate to contact us. We’ll work with you to restore your home to its former glory.

Trim & Baseboard Replacement After Water Damage Cost in Grand Ronde, OR
The cost of Trim & Baseboard Replacement After Water Damage in Grand Ronde, OR can vary a lot depending on the severity, size of the affected area, and local conditions. These estimates are based on industry standards and our experience working with homeowners in the area. Keep in mind that exact pricing depends on an on-site assessment and free estimates are available.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Trim & Baseboard Removal and Replacement | $500 – $2,500 | Size of affected area, material selection, and labor costs |
| Drying Equipment Rental and Deposition | $500 – $2,000 | Equipment type and rental duration |
| Specialized Materials and Supplies | $200 – $1,000 | Material quality and quantity required |
| Insurance Claim Help and Documentation | $0 – $500 | Insurance policy complexity and adjuster involvement |
| More Repairs (e.g., drywall, painting) | $500 – $5,000 | Scope and complexity of more repairs |
